Brick flatwork repair services involve restoring and maintaining the horizontal surfaces made from brick materials, such as walkways, patios, driveways, and porch decks. Over time, exposure to weather, ground movement, and regular use can cause these surfaces to develop issues like cracks, uneven areas, or loose bricks. Skilled service providers assess the condition of the brickwork, remove damaged sections if necessary, and carefully replace or repair bricks to restore a smooth, level, and stable surface. Proper repair not only improves the appearance of the property but also helps prevent further damage and extends the lifespan of the brick surfaces.
Many common problems that brick flatwork repair addresses are related to cracking, shifting, and deterioration. Cracks can occur due to ground settling or temperature changes, leading to tripping hazards or water infiltration that can cause more extensive damage. Loose or uneven bricks may result from poor initial installation or ongoing ground movement. In cases where bricks are sinking or shifting, repairs can stabilize the surface and prevent further structural issues. Repairing these problems promptly can help homeowners maintain a safe outdoor environment and avoid more costly repairs down the line.

The overview below groups typical Brick Flatwork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Bloomington, IL.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Most minor brick flatwork repairs in Bloomington typically range from $250 to $600. Many routine fixes, like replacing a few damaged bricks or patching cracks, fall within this band. Fewer projects reach the higher end unless multiple repairs are needed.
Moderate Projects - Mid-sized repairs or partial replacements usually cost between $600 and $1,500. These projects often involve replacing sections of flatwork or addressing more extensive damage, with local contractors often handling these regularly.
Large Repairs - Extensive repairs or multiple sections requiring attention can range from $1,500 to $3,500. Larger, more complex projects, such as rebuilding sections of flatwork or significant crack repairs, tend to push into this range.
Full Replacement - Complete flatwork replacement projects in Bloomington can start around $3,500 and may exceed $5,000 for very large or intricate jobs. Many full replacements are less common but are handled by local pros for larger properties or heavily damaged areas.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What types of brick flatwork repairs do local contractors handle? Local service providers can address issues such as cracked or chipped bricks, uneven surfaces, and deteriorated mortar joints to restore the integrity and appearance of brick flatwork.
How can I tell if my brick flatwork needs repair? Signs include visible cracks, loose or shifting bricks, spalling, or water pooling on the surface, indicating that repairs may be necessary to prevent further damage.
Are there different repair methods for brick flatwork? Yes, local contractors may use techniques like tuckpointing, replacing damaged bricks, or re-leveling surfaces to effectively repair and reinforce brick flatwork.
What are common causes of damage to brick flatwork? Damage often results from freeze-thaw cycles, moisture infiltration, settling soil, or physical impacts that weaken the structure over time.
